#580ba9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#580ba9 is composed of 34.5% red, 4.3%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 269.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 35.3%. #580ba9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b016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#580ba9 color description : Dark violet.

#580ba9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#580ba9 has RGB values of R:88, G:11,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 5770153.

Shades and Tints of #580ba9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f7f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#580ba9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a575d is the less saturated color, while #5804b0 is the most saturated one.
